重复降维数据分析怎么做
-
重复降维数据分析是一种常见的数据处理技术,用于减少数据集中的特征数量,同时保留数据中的重要信息。下面将介绍重复降维数据分析的具体步骤:
- 理解重复数据
首先,需要对数据集中的重复数据进行理解和处理。重复数据可能会对数据的分析造成影响,因此首先需要确保数据集中没有重复的数据。
- 选择合适的降维方法
在进行重复降维数据分析之前,需要选择合适的降维方法。常见的降维方法包括主成分分析(PCA)、线性判别分析(LDA)和 t-SNE 等。根据数据集的特点和分析的目的选择合适的降维方法。
- 数据预处理
在进行重复降维数据分析之前,需要对数据进行预处理。包括数据清洗、缺失值处理、标准化等步骤,以确保数据的质量和一致性。
- 应用重复降维算法
接下来,将选定的降维方法应用到数据集上,将高维数据转换为低维数据。重复降维算法会通过保留最具信息量的特征,把数据映射到一个更低维度的空间中。
- 评估降维效果
在完成重复降维后,需要评估降维的效果。可以通过可视化的方式观察数据在降维后的分布情况,或者通过一些评估指标(如方差解释率)来评估降维后是否保留了足够的信息。
- 利用降维后的数据进行分析
最后,可以利用降维后的数据进行进一步的分析,例如聚类、分类或可视化等。降维后的数据可能更易于处理和理解,有助于发现数据间的相关性和规律。
综上所述,重复降维数据分析是一项重要的数据处理技术,通过减少数据集的特征数量,可以简化数据分析的复杂度,同时保留数据中的重要信息,有助于提高数据分析的效率和准确性。
1周前 -
重复降维数据分析,也称为迁移学习中的领域自适应(domain adaptation),是将一个领域的数据通过降维技术应用到另一个不同领域的数据中以提升模型性能的过程。以下是进行重复降维数据分析的一般步骤和方法:
-
数据准备:首先,需要收集和准备两个领域的数据集,包括源领域数据和目标领域数据。这两个数据集可能在特征分布或标签分布上存在差异。通常,源领域的数据量较大,而目标领域的数据量相对较小。
-
特征选择:对源领域数据进行特征选择,保留对目标领域有用的特征。常用的特征选择方法包括过滤法、包装法和嵌入法。特征选择有助于提取出对领域自适应有帮助的特征,减小数据维度。
-
重复降维技术选择:选择适合的重复降维技术来处理源领域数据。常用的重复降维技术包括主成分分析(PCA)、线性判别分析(LDA)、t-分布邻域嵌入(t-SNE)等。这些技术可以帮助将数据映射到低维空间并保留数据内在结构。
-
迁移学习模型训练:将经过降维处理的源领域数据用于训练迁移学习模型。在模型训练过程中,需要考虑如何将源领域数据的知识迁移至目标领域数据,以适应目标领域的特点。常用的迁移学习方法包括最大均值差异最小化(MMD)、领域对齐(Domain Alignment)等。
-
模型评估与调优:使用目标领域数据对迁移学习模型进行评估,并根据评估结果对模型进行调优。可以通过交叉验证、混淆矩阵等指标来评估模型性能,同时也可以调整模型参数以提升模型的泛化能力。
-
迁移学习模型应用:最终,将经过重复降维处理和迁移学习训练的模型应用于目标领域数据,以提升对目标领域数据的预测准确性和泛化能力。
重复降维数据分析在迁移学习领域中具有重要意义,能够帮助解决数据分布不同导致的领域适应性问题。通过合适的数据处理和模型训练,可以有效地利用源领域数据中的知识,提升对目标领域数据的处理效果,从而实现数据分析的准确性和可靠性。
1周前 -
-
重复降维数据分析方法与流程
1. 了解重复数据问题
在进行数据分析过程中,我们常常会遇到重复数据的问题。这些重复数据可能会导致数据分析结果的偏差,影响数据分析的准确性。因此,需要对重复数据进行降维处理,以确保数据分析的准确性和有效性。
2. 重复数据的检测
在进行重复数据降维之前,首先需要对数据进行重复数据的检测。常用的方法包括:
2.1. 判断重复数据行
通过比较数据行的各个字段,判断是否存在完全相同的数据行,如果存在则视为重复数据行。
2.2. 判断重复数据列
对数据表的每一列进行对比,判断是否存在完全相同的数据列,如果存在则视为重复数据列。
2.3. 基于主键的重复数据判断
对于包含主键的数据表,可以通过主键判断是否存在重复数据,如果主键重复则说明存在重复数据。
3. 重复数据降维方法
在检测到重复数据之后,需要对重复数据进行降维处理。常用的重复数据降维方法包括:
3.1. 删除重复数据行
最简单的方法是直接删除重复数据行,保留一条数据作为代表。这种方法适用于数据集中存在大量完全重复的数据行的情况。
3.2. 合并重复数据行
对于重复数据行,可以将它们合并为一条数据,合并的方式可以是取平均值、取最大值、取最小值等。这种方法适用于数值型数据的情况。
3.3. 删除重复数据列
对于重复数据列,可以直接删除其中一列或多列,保留一列作为代表。这种方法适用于数据表中存在大量重复数据列的情况。
3.4. 主成分分析(PCA)
主成分分析是一种常用的降维方法,通过线性变换将原始数据转换为一组正交的主成分,使得转换后的数据保留原始数据的大部分信息。可以通过主成分分析对数据进行降维,减少冗余信息。
3.5. 特征选择
特征选择是一种常用的降维方法,通过选择最具代表性的特征,去除冗余信息,从而降低数据维度。
4. 重复数据降维操作流程
在实际进行重复数据降维时,可以按照以下步骤进行操作:
4.1. 检测重复数据
- 使用统计软件或编程语言进行重复数据的检测,例如Python中的pandas库、R语言等。
- 判断重复数据行、列,查看是否有完全重复的数据行或数据列。
4.2. 选择合适的降维方法
- 根据数据类型和具体情况选择合适的降维方法,可以根据实际需求进行选择。
4.3. 执行重复数据降维
- 根据选择的降维方法,对重复数据进行降维处理,如删除重复数据行、合并数据行、删除重复数据列等。
4.4. 验证降维效果
- 在进行重复数据降维后,可以再次检测数据,验证降维效果是否符合期望。
- 可以对降维后的数据进行进一步的数据分析,评估数据分析结果的准确性。
5. 总结
重复数据降维是数据分析过程中重要的一环,通过对重复数据的检测和降维处理,可以提高数据分析结果的准确性和有效性。在实际操作中,需要根据具体情况选择合适的降维方法,并验证降维效果,确保数据分析的准确性。
1周前